Local tips

  • Visit during the morning for a quieter experience and better chances of interacting with artisans.
  • Don’t forget to bargain! It’s a common practice and can lead to great deals on unique items.
  • Try the local street food for an authentic taste of Bali—be sure to sample different dishes.
  • Bring cash, as many vendors may not accept credit cards.

Getting There

  • Walk

    If you are staying in central Ubud, you can simply walk to the Ubud Artisan Market. Head north on Jl. Monkey Forest until you reach the intersection with Jl. Raya Ubud. Turn left onto Jl. Raya Ubud and continue walking for about 10-15 minutes. You will see the market on your right at Jl. Raya Sanggingan. Look for the colorful stalls and the bustling atmosphere.

  • Bicycle

    For those who prefer cycling, you can rent a bicycle from various rental shops around Ubud. Start your journey heading north on Jl. Monkey Forest, then turn left onto Jl. Raya Ubud. Continue straight until you reach Jl. Raya Sanggingan. The Ubud Artisan Market will be on your right. The ride should take around 10 minutes, depending on your speed.

  • Public Transport (Bemo)

    To reach Ubud Artisan Market using a bemo (local minibus), find a bemo stop in Ubud. Take a bemo heading towards Kedewatan. Inform the driver that you want to get off at Jl. Raya Sanggingan. Once you arrive, the market will be a short walk from the drop-off point. Look for signs or ask locals for directions if needed.

Discover more about Ubud Artisan Market

The Ubud Artisan Market is a must-visit destination for anyone traveling to Bali, particularly those eager to experience the rich local culture and artistry that the region is known for. Located in the charming town of Ubud, the market showcases a plethora of artisanal crafts, including traditional Balinese textiles, intricate wood carvings, and beautiful handmade jewelry. As you wander through the colorful stalls, you’ll encounter friendly artisans eager to share the stories behind their creations, offering a unique glimpse into Bali’s vibrant cultural heritage. In addition to crafts, the market also offers a variety of local street food stalls, where visitors can indulge in traditional delicacies such as satay, nasi goreng, and fresh tropical fruits. The bustling atmosphere, filled with the sounds of laughter and the aroma of delicious food, makes it a perfect spot to relax and soak in the local ambiance.
